Transaction 171e5ad3f01f42251246982ec924600ccb5511688a5b0d1d9858001409937789

2 Input
2 Outputs
  • 171e5ad3f01f42251246982ec924600ccb5511688a5b0d1d9858001409937789:0
  • value  5622065
    address  1Hbzd23UttqChmhDjYkx4N9iHb8x7cVBBa
  • 171e5ad3f01f42251246982ec924600ccb5511688a5b0d1d9858001409937789:1
  • value  15100544
    address  3AMPBC2KQfKWji1AMXqvSGe4pERQvy9d1J